Projects that will be considered for Pfizer support will focus on preparing and/or optimizing multidisciplinary care teams for the integration of gene therapy into the treatment armamentarium for patients with a Rare Disease.

Support is available for the development of leadership, best practices, SOP development, site readiness, support and/or training of HCPs within a multidisciplinary team environment to optimize the quality of care for patients who have/will have gene therapy in their treatment armamentarium.

Projects that address recombinant adeno-associated virus gene therapy in Rare Disease and are therapeutic area and disease area agnostic (i.e., platform) will be prioritized

It is not our intent to support clinical research projects. Projects evaluating the efficacy of therapeutic or diagnostic agents will not be considered.

Individual projects requesting up to $50,000 will be considered. The estimated total available budget related to this RFP is $150,000

Requisits

Members of multidisciplinary care teams for gene therapy including but not limited to Medical Geneticists, Genetic Counsellors, Pharmacists, and Specialist Nurses.
